Product Overview

The MDS TransNET utilizes FHSS (Frequency Hopping Spread Spectrum) in the ISM Band of 902 – 928 MHz to provide reliable long range data transportation at up to 115.2 kbps. The TransNET provides transparent data communications for nearly all SCADA/Telemetry and EFM protocols including MODBUS.

Any MDS TransNET may be configured as a repeater extension. This allows store and forward data operation to extend the operating range of the network. Mulitple repeaters may exist at any level of the network preventing a single radio failure from disabling the entire network. There is no limit to the number of repeaters which may be used. This product is available for use in Class 1, Division 2, Groups A, B, C & D hazardous locations.*

Specifications


Data Characteristics
Interface: RS-232/RS-485 (User Selectable)
Usable Throughput: 115.2 kbps
Port Speed: 1.2 to 115.2 kbps


Transmitter
Power Output: 1 Watt (30 dBm) at 6Vdc to 30 Vdc, user selectable down to 100 mw (+20 dBm)
Modulation: CPFSK


Receiver
Sensitivity: -108 dBm (1 x 10-6 BER) typical
Error Detection: CRC16; Resend on Error
Interference Avoidance:
  • 64,000 hop patterns selected automatically via network address
  • FEC, CRC/ARQ and/or Multiple Packet Transmits
  • Excellent Strong Signal (interference) Characteristics
  • Band Segmentation for Friendly Coexistence with Other Services such as LMS


Connectors
Power and User: 2 Pin Phoenix, DB-9, RJ11
RF: TNC


Environmental
Humidity: < 95% RH (Non-Condensing)
Temperature Range: -40° C to +70° C
Current Consumption:
Mode 30 Vdc 13.8 Vdc 6 Vdc
Transmit 236 mA 510 mA 1.18 A
Receive 51 mA 100 mA 155 mA
Sleep Mode : 7 mA typical
Input Power: 6 to 30 Vdc


Physical
Dimensions: (approx. 3.5 D x 5 W x 1 H inches)
(approx. 8.9 D x 12.7 W x 2.5 H cm)


Operating Modes
Point-to-Point: Full Duplex (57.6 kbps) TDD
Point-to-Multipoint: Master
Remote
Repeater Extension (Store-and Forward) - Unlimited Repeaters; Self-healing Networks
